CONIFER, Colo. — A barricaded gunman in Conifer died by suicide Friday, according to the Jefferson County Sheriff's Office.
In a 3:29 p.m. social media post, JCSO said it was "working a barricaded gunman situation" in the 12000 block of Critchell Lane in Conifer.
In an update at 5:34 p.m., the sheriff's office said the situation was "resolved" and the suspect died by "apparent suicide."
A shelter-in-place order was been issued for residents within a 1/4 mile. The order has since been lifted.
